dr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_comms.c uses
full memory barriers to communicate with the other side.

For guests compiled with CONFIG_SMP, smp_wmb and smp_mb
would be sufficient, so mb() and wmb() here are only needed if
a non-SMP guest runs on an SMP host.

Switch to __smp_XXX barriers which serve this exact purpose.

diff --git a/dr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_comms.c b/dr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_comms.c
index fdb0f33..09b17c7 100644
--- a/dr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_comms.c
+++ b/dr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_comms.c
@@ -123,14 +123,14 @@ int xb_write(const void *data, unsigned len)
 			avail = len;
 
 		/* Must write data /after/ reading the consumer index. */
-		mb();
+		__smp_mb();
 
 		memcpy(dst, data, avail);
 		data += avail;
 		len -= avail;
 
 		/* Other side must not see new producer until data is there. */
-		wmb();
+		__smp_wmb();
 		intf->req_prod += avail;
 
 		/* Implies mb(): other side will see the updated producer. */
@@ -180,14 +180,14 @@ int xb_read(void *data, unsigned len)
 			avail = len;
 
 		/* Must read data /after/ reading the producer index. */
-		rmb();
+		__smp_rmb();
 
 		memcpy(data, src, avail);
 		data += avail;
 		len -= avail;
 
 		/* Other side must not see free space until we've copied out */
-		mb();
+		__smp_mb();
 		intf->rsp_cons += avail;
 
 		pr_debug("Finished read of %i bytes (%i to go)\n", avail, len);
